We had the opportunity to participate in a give back activity through a co-worker’s foundation and got to spend a Saturday with some wonderful kids at a Safe Home on the outskirts of Johannesburg. These children are taken from their homes–due to abuse, neglect, runaways, etc. A wonderful Indian couple has opened up their home and without any funding from the government, started this safe home for children. When we were there, they housed 14 kids ranging from 2 up to 14 in a 3 bdrm 1000 sq. foot home. I was so impressed by their big hearts and humility. We spent the morning reading, wrestling and just playing with the children. It was great for Aubrey, Emmaus, Titan and Rajko to also experience the joy of giving away their things to other children who need it more. We will definitely go back again for a visit soon!
